Diapers aren't covered by food stamps — in California, they're classified along with cigarettes and alcohol as invalid purchases — nor by the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) nutrition program for low-income mothers. You do get more food stamps when another child arrives.Sep 2, 2016

South Jersey Dream Center : This organization in South Jersey passes along your items, free of cost, to local families who are struggling to make ends meet. South Jersey Dream Center only accepts quality items– clothes that are in good condition, baby equipment that is safe and sound, and toys that are complete.
Madonna House: Madonna House is dedicated to serving babies, children and women by providing clothing, kids furniture, toys, infant formula, diapers, small household items and other life necessities to impoverished and needy families – free of charge.
